Influence of Sunshine Intensity



Sometimes, the strength of sunlight can substantially influence the effectiveness of photovoltaic panels. When the sunlight is solid and direct, your photovoltaic panels generate even more electrical energy. Nonetheless, during gloomy days or when the sun goes to a low angle, the panels obtain much less sunshine, minimizing their efficiency. To maximize the power outcome of your solar panels, it's vital to install them in locations with enough sunlight direct exposure throughout the day. Take into consideration aspects like shading from nearby trees or buildings that could obstruct sunshine and decrease the panels' efficiency.

To maximize the efficiency of your photovoltaic panels, consistently tidy them to eliminate any dirt, dust, or particles that might be obstructing sunshine absorption. Additionally, make certain that your panels are angled appropriately to obtain the most straight sunshine feasible.

Influence of Temperature Adjustments



When temperature level modifications occur, they can have a substantial influence on the effectiveness of solar panels. Photovoltaic panel operate best in cooler temperatures, making them extra effective on moderate days contrasted to very warm ones. As the temperature level increases, photovoltaic panels can experience a decline in effectiveness because of a phenomenon called the temperature level coefficient. This effect creates a reduction in voltage result, eventually impacting the general power manufacturing of the panels.

Alternatively, when temperature levels drop also low, photovoltaic panels can likewise be impacted. Extremely cold temperatures can cause a reduction in conductivity within the panels, making them much less reliable in producing electrical energy. This is why it's vital to take into consideration the temperature level conditions when installing solar panels to maximize their performance.

Duty of Cloud Cover and Rainfall



Cloud cover and rains can substantially impact the effectiveness of photovoltaic panels. When clouds obstruct the sun, the amount of sunshine reaching your photovoltaic panels is decreased, leading to a reduction in energy production. Rainfall can likewise affect photovoltaic panel performance by blocking sunshine and creating a layer of dirt or grime on the panels, better minimizing their capacity to generate electricity. Even light rainfall can spread sunshine, causing it to be less focused on the panels.



During overcast days with hefty cloud cover, solar panels might experience a considerable drop in energy output. However, it's worth keeping in mind that some modern-day photovoltaic panel innovations can still create electrical energy also when the skies is cloudy. Furthermore, rain can have a cleansing impact on solar panels, getting rid of dust and dirt that may have accumulated gradually.

To take full advantage of the performance of your photovoltaic panels, it's essential to think about the effect of cloud cover and rainfall on energy production and make certain that your panels are correctly preserved to stand up to varying weather.
